Okay, the fretless is done. I'll probably leave the fretted until tomorrow.

I'm surprised no one guessed. All I'm doing is installing recessed Dunlop straplocks.
I've never liked the way the Dunlop straplocks looked on the Bongos, and I absolutely despise the Schaller straplock system.

Now the strap is flush with the Bongo body, and all looks great! Since the body is so rounded, I want to get some black rubber washers on there before I post pics. I'm also waiting for a couple of other things to show up.... :cool:

Pics, finally....

Okay, here are some pics of Moby with the recessed strap locks.

Since both the horn and body are so curved, I went to Home Depot and got some rubber grommets to put underneath the straplock. Of course, this makes them not quite as flush as they'd be without them, but it's still a major improvement, and I think they look nice, too.
